Crispy Hash Brown Egg Nests Recipe Easy Cheddar Chive Breakfast

crispy hash brown egg nests - featured image

These crispy hash brown egg nests with cheddar and chive are a quick and easy breakfast or brunch option featuring golden, crispy potato nests holding perfectly baked eggs with a fresh burst of chives.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 cups (about 10.5 oz / 300g) frozen shredded hash browns
  • 1 cup (about 3.5 oz / 100g) shredded cheddar cheese
  • 6 large eggs, room temperature
  • 2 tablespoons finely chopped fresh chives
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il or melted butter
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on freshly cracked black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Grease a 12-cup muffin tin with olive oil or melted butter.
  3. In a large bowl, toss the frozen hash browns with olive oil or melted butter, salt, black pepper, and optional garlic powder until evenly coated.
  4. Add shredded cheddar cheese to the mixture and stir gently to combine.
  5. Divide the hash brown mixture evenly among the muffin tin cups, pressing the potatoes against the sides and bottom to form a nest shape with a well in the center.
  6. Bake the nests for 15 minutes until the edges start turning golden and crispy.
  7. Carefully crack one large egg into each nest, avoiding breaking the yolk. For more cooked yolks, lightly whisk eggs before pouring.
  8. Return the muffin tin to the oven and bake for 10-12 more minutes, or until egg whites are set but yolks are still slightly runny. Add a few extra minutes for firmer yolks.
  9. Remove from oven and sprinkle chopped fresh chives over the top of each nest.
  10. Let the nests cool for 2-3 minutes before carefully removing them with a small spatula or spoon. Serve warm.

Notes

Do not fully thaw hash browns; slightly frozen works best for crispiness. Press hash browns firmly but not too compact to ensure nests hold shape and crisp. Use room temperature eggs for even cooking. Rotate pan halfway through baking eggs for even heat. For extra crispiness, broil nests 1-2 minutes after baking. Avoid microwaving leftovers to maintain crispiness.
